About this campground

South Iron Springs Group Site

South Iron Springs Group Site is a beautiful camping area located in Utah. This campground provides a range of amenities to ensure a comfortable camping experience. The site offers picnic tables, fire rings, and vault toilets, making it suitable for both tent camping and RVs. Furthermore, potable water is available nearby, but it is recommended to bring your own supply.

Reservations are required to secure a spot at South Iron Springs Group Site. It is advisable to book well in advance, especially during peak season, as the campground can fill up quickly. The best time to visit this camping area is during the summer or early fall months when the weather is pleasant and suitable for outdoor activities.

Visitors to South Iron Springs Group Site will find themselves surrounded by stunning landscapes and an abundance of recreational opportunities. The area is renowned for its hiking trails, fishing spots, and wildlife viewing opportunities. However, caution must be exercised as black bears are known to frequent the area, so proper food storage is crucial. Additionally, visitors should be aware of the potential for sudden weather changes and flash floods, as the campground is situated within a desert environment.

Overall, South Iron Springs Group Site is a fantastic camping destination in Utah, offering amenities, stunning scenery, and various activities for outdoor enthusiasts.

Camping essentials & Leave No Trace

Pack it in, pack it out
Take all trash, food scraps, and gear back with you to keep campsites clean and protect wildlife.
Respect wildlife
Observe animals from a distance, store food securely, and never feed wildlife to maintain natural behavior and safety.
Know before you go
Check weather, fire restrictions, trail conditions, and permit requirements to ensure a safe and well-planned trip.
Minimize campfire impact
Use established fire rings, keep fires small, fully extinguish them, or opt for a camp stove when fires are restricted.
Leave what you find
Preserve natural and cultural features by avoiding removal of plants, rocks, artifacts, or other elements of the environment.
